Order Management Specialist
Job Description
The Order Management Specialist manages customer orders from purchase order receipt through shipment and delivery, ensuring accuracy, timeliness, and compliance with company policies. This role serves as the primary escalation point for complex order-related issues, coordinates closely with cross-functional teams, and drives continuous improvement in order execution, customer service, and operational efficiency. The specialist also supports and enhances ERP and CRM processes, maintains high data quality, and helps standardize order management procedures across the organization.
Responsibilities
+ Manage customer orders from purchase order receipt through shipment and final delivery, ensuring on-time and accurate fulfillment.
+ Review incoming orders for completeness, pricing accuracy, technical requirements, and compliance with company policies and procedures.
+ Serve as the primary escalation point for complex order-related issues, delays, and customer concerns, providing timely resolution and clear communication.
+ Coordinate activities between Sales, Engineering, Production, Procurement, Logistics, and Finance to ensure successful order fulfillment.
+ Monitor order backlog, production schedules, and shipment commitments to proactively identify risks and implement corrective actions.
+ Communicate order status, schedule changes, and delivery expectations to customers and internal stakeholders in a clear and timely manner.
+ Manage domestic and international drop shipment activities, including orders fulfilled directly from sister companies and global partners.
+ Resolve order discrepancies related to pricing and other commercial terms, working closely with relevant internal teams.
+ Support invoicing activities and ensure all required shipment and export documentation is accurately completed and properly maintained.
+ Maintain accurate customer and order records within ERP and CRM systems, ensuring data integrity and traceability.
+ Provide guidance and support to internal users on ERP and related systems, including system functionality, process execution, and best practices.
+ Identify system gaps, process inefficiencies, and opportunities for automation and process improvement within order management and related workflows.
+ Participate in system testing, validation, troubleshooting, and user acceptance testing for ERP and related system changes or enhancements.
+ Monitor and maintain data quality in ERP and CRM systems, ensuring compliance with established business processes and standards.
+ Develop and maintain training materials, process maps, user guides, and standard operating procedures related to ERP functionality and order management processes.
+ Train and support new and existing employees on ERP functionality, order entry, and end-to-end order management processes.
+ Lead continuous improvement initiatives focused on order execution, customer service, and operational efficiency.
+ Establish and maintain standardized order management procedures across the organization to ensure consistency and scalability.
+ Collaborate with global stakeholders and sister companies to align order management processes and share best practices.
+ Analyze recurring issues, perform root cause analysis, and recommend or implement corrective actions to prevent reoccurrence.
